Preserving Biodiversity in Our Town

"Preserving Biodiversity in Our Town" will be the topic of a seminar hosted by the Conservation Advisory Council (CAC) of Cortlandt on March 10 from 7 p.m. to 9 p.m. in the main meeting room at Cortlandt Town Hall. 

Michael J. Rubbo, Ph.D, from Teatown Lake Reservation will be the guest speaker. The program, including a question and answer period, is free and open to the public.
